FLAMMABLE LIQUID STORAGE CABINETS August 1st 2004 The Dangerous Substances and Explosive Atmospheres Regulations 2002 (DSEAR) includes an explanation of the standards that cabinets and enclosures must meet if they are tested.
Walter Page (Safeways) claims to be the first company to independently test flammable liquid storage cabinets to ensure that they comply.
Cabinets were tested by a leading fire research, testing and consulting agency. Fire performance was tested using the heating conditions of BS476:Part 20:1987 and en1363-1:1999.
The cabinets passed the appropriate test criteria and after the test it was ascertained that both sumps in the cabinet were liquid tight and that the doors could be easily opened and closed by hand. A copy of the Test Confirmation is available upon request.
